William "Bill" McCoy Obituary

William “Bill” Howard McCoy, age 75, of Concord died Sunday December 27, 2020 battling cancer.

Bill was born March 12, 1945 in Charlotte, NC to the late Howard Lee McCoy and Ruby Blalock McCoy.  A lifelong area resident, Bill graduated from North Mecklenburg High School followed with service in the Army and deployment to Vietnam, receiving a Bronze Star.  After returning to the United States, Bill met and quickly married the love of his life, Kim and soon thereafter expanded to a family of four having two daughters.  After a brief time working at Johnson Motor Lines, Bill pursued an advanced business associate degree at Rowan Community College and joined IBM in Charlotte working in Procurement, where he enjoyed the challenges of his work and the camaraderie with his colleagues. Outside of work, he loved the sport of bass fishing.  He relished waking up before dawn to get on the lake with bass club friends and family to find the big ones.

Throughout his life, Bill loved people and was beloved by many.  He was the extrovert of extroverts.  To meet Bill was to feel like you had known him for a lifetime.  Almost without fail, he would be the first to reach out with a firm handshake and introduce himself with a strong and confident voice, yet with a natural ease that drew one in immediately.  If the situation allowed, Bill was ready to share a story, a joke, or just easy conversation because he loved talking!  There was never a lag in conversation whenever he was around. He could out talk anyone, yet was it was never too much and was often filled with laughter.

He will be fondly remembered for the joy he brought into our lives, his quick wit, the encouragement that was ever present, consistent positive outlook and his love for telling humorous stories and jokes.  We miss him so much already.

He is survived by his beloved wife of 49 years, Kim McCoy of the home; his daughters Vicki Everett (Rob) of Raleigh and Misty Winn (Will) of Charlotte; and his cherished grandchildren Fisher, Madison, Weston Winn and Graham Everett as well as his brother Harold McCoy and sisters Carol Johnson and Teresa Wells.
